Kuwait's geographic location presents a harsh environment for internal combustion engines. The combination of extreme summer temperatures, often exceeding 50°C, and pervasive fine desert sand leads to rapid degradation of lubricant quality. This creates an urgent need for a high-efficiency automotive oil filter that can maintain flow rates while trapping microscopic contaminants.
The local market is characterized by a high prevalence of luxury SUVs and heavy-duty pickup trucks. These vehicles operate under severe load conditions, accelerating the buildup of sludge and carbon deposits. Consequently, the interval for replacing an oil filter automotive is significantly shorter in Kuwait compared to temperate regions to prevent engine overheating and premature wear.
Economically, Kuwait's automotive sector is shifting toward higher standards of preventative maintenance. There is a growing professional demand for premium filtration media that can withstand thermal expansion and contraction without compromising the structural integrity of the seal, ensuring that oil circulation remains uninterrupted during peak summer heat.
